What Is the Narcissistic Abuse Cycle? The narcissistic abuse cycle is an abusive pattern of behavior that characterizes narcissistic people's relationships. It entails idealizing someone, then depreciating them, repeating the cycle, and finally dismissing them when they are no longer useful. People with narcissistic personality disorder (NPD), sometimes known as narcissists, have an inflated sense of self, unrealistic expectations of favorable treatment, and a distinct lack of empathy for others. People with narcissistic qualities frequently struggle to sustain interpersonal relationships in all aspects of their lives, including at home, at work, and in the community. Their connections with others can be emotionally abusive at times.
